Direct answer
Mark Butler was elected.
After preferences, Mark Butler received 74,623 votes (66.35%). Chris Lehmann received 37,848 votes (33.65%).

Complete candidate result
All 9 candidates.
Ranked here by first-preference votes. The elected member is determined by the full preferential count, not necessarily the primary-vote order.
| Primary rank | Candidate | Party | Ballot | First preferences | Primary share | Final TCP |
|---|
| 1 | Mark ButlerElectedAEC historical incumbent marker | Australian Labor Party | 8 | 54,145 | 48.14% | 74,623 · 66.35% · +7.40 pp swing |
|---|
| 2 | Chris Lehmann | Liberal | 5 | 25,984 | 23.10% | 37,848 · 33.65% · -7.40 pp swing |
|---|
| 3 | Matthew Wright | The Greens | 9 | 15,246 | 13.56%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 4 | Rocco Deangelis | Pauline Hanson's One Nation | 4 | 5,594 | 4.97%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 5 | Andrew Townsend | Trumpet of Patriots | 1 | 4,782 | 4.25%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 6 | Alex Tennikoff | Family First | 3 | 2,646 | 2.35%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 7 | Jake Hall-Evans | Independent | 7 | 1,786 | 1.59%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 8 | Matt Pastro | Animal Justice Party | 6 | 1,565 | 1.39% | Not a TCP finalist |
|---|
| 9 | Adrien Aloe | FUSION | Planet Rescue | Whistleblower Protection | Innovation | 2 | 723 | 0.64% | Not a TCP finalist |
